Gary D. Cage is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Gary D. Cage has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 534 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Epidemiology, 8 papers in Infectious Diseases and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Gary D. Cage’s work include Mycobacterium research and diagnosis (6 papers), Legionella and Acanthamoeba research (4 papers)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(4 papers). Gary D. Cage is often cited by papers focused on Mycobacterium research and diagnosis (6 papers), Legionella and Acanthamoeba research (4 papers)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(4 papers). Gary D. Cage collaborates with scholars based in United States. Gary D. Cage's co-authors include Kenneth Komatsu, Nancy H. Bean, Patricia M. Griffin, Clare M. Kioski, M A Lambert-Fair, Laurence Slutsker, Anja Siitonen, William N. Hall, Stephen Dietrich and Peggy S. Hayes and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, Journal of Clinical Microbiology and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
